Architect? A Candid Guide to the Profession, Revised Edition
First published in 1985, Architect? A Candid Guide to the Profession quickly became known as the best basic guide to the architectural field. Within a decade, it was a standard text for introductory courses on architecture and recommended reading for aspiring architects applying to schools.

Drawing for Architecture
In Drawing for Architecture, architect Léon Krier makes an argument against what he sees as the unquestioned doctrines and unacknowledged absurdities of contemporary architecture. Through more than 200 provocative doodles, drawings, and ideograms he calls for a return to traditional architecture.
